MDS is a group of blood disorders in which the bone marrow does not produce enough healthy blood cells. It most commonly affects people over the age of 65, making age-related health factors a central part of how care is planned. Because MDS varies widely in its behavior and severity, no single treatment approach fits every patient. Instead, decisions are shaped by how the disease is classified, the patient’s overall health, and their personal goals for care.
How MDS Subtype and Risk Affect Treatment
One of the first steps after diagnosis is determining a patient’s risk category. Tools like the Revised International Prognostic Scoring System, or IPSS-R, help hematologists classify MDS as lower-risk or higher-risk based on factors such as bone marrow blast percentage, chromosome changes, and blood cell counts. This classification has a direct impact on which treatments are considered appropriate. Lower-risk MDS tends to progress more slowly and may not require aggressive intervention right away. Higher-risk MDS carries a greater chance of progressing to acute myeloid leukemia and often calls for more active treatment strategies.
Low-Risk and High-Risk MDS Care Options
For patients with lower-risk MDS, the primary focus is often on managing symptoms and maintaining quality of life. Erythropoiesis-stimulating agents, or ESAs, may be used to reduce anemia-related fatigue. Some patients with a specific chromosome deletion, known as del(5q), respond well to lenalidomide. In cases where ESAs are no longer effective, luspatercept has shown benefit for certain subtypes. For higher-risk MDS, hypomethylating agents such as azacitidine and decitabine are commonly used to slow disease progression. These are typically given in cycles and require regular monitoring. Stem cell transplant remains the only potentially curative option for eligible patients, though age and overall health must be carefully weighed before pursuing this path.
Supportive Care and Disease-Directed Treatment
Supportive care plays a meaningful role at every stage of MDS management. Red blood cell transfusions help manage severe anemia, while platelet transfusions may be used when bleeding risk is elevated. Iron chelation therapy is sometimes considered for patients who receive frequent transfusions and develop iron overload. These supportive measures do not alter the underlying disease but can significantly improve daily functioning and comfort. Disease-directed treatments, by contrast, aim to slow progression or modify how the bone marrow behaves. The balance between these two approaches depends on the individual’s risk profile, treatment tolerance, and personal priorities. For many older adults, maintaining independence and managing fatigue can weigh just as heavily as extending survival in treatment discussions.
Treatment Decisions for Older Adults With MDS
Age alone does not determine what treatment is appropriate, but it does introduce additional considerations. Older adults are more likely to have other health conditions, take multiple medications, and experience greater sensitivity to treatment side effects. Geriatric assessments, which evaluate physical function, cognitive health, and social support, are increasingly used alongside standard medical evaluations to guide treatment planning. Frailty assessments help identify patients who may benefit from less intensive approaches. Conversations about goals of care, including what matters most to the patient beyond survival, are considered an essential part of decision-making in this population.
Questions for a Hematology Consultation
Preparing for a visit with a hematologist or oncologist can help patients and caregivers make the most of limited appointment time. Some useful questions to consider include: What is my MDS risk category and what does that mean for my treatment options? Are there clinical trials that may be appropriate for me? How will treatment affect my daily routine and independence? What are the realistic goals of the recommended treatment, and how will we know if it is working? Asking about second opinions is also appropriate, particularly when treatment decisions involve significant trade-offs. Many academic medical centers have dedicated MDS programs where specialists focus specifically on these disorders.
